Based on limited published evidence, KRTAP9-4 encodes a keratin-associated protein that functions in hair shaft structural integrity. According to UniProt annotations, KRTAP9-4 is embedded within the hair cortex matrix and participates in extensive disulfide bond cross-linking with hair keratins to form rigid, resistant hair shafts [UniProt]. The protein exhibits cytosolic localization and protein-binding capability. A recent exome-wide association study identified a KRTAP9-4 variant in the 3' untranslated region as significantly associated with suicidal ideation in a veteran cohort 1, though the biological relevance of this association to the protein's known hair structural role remains unclear.
